From £22Explore Bristol's Iconic Victorian Steamship
These tickets allow all-day access to the iconic steamship, dockyard and two museums at Bristol Dockyards. Sitting proudly on the glass ‘sea’, SS Great Britain dominates Bristol’s historic waterfront. Dressed with flags and ready for departure, just as the ship looked when it was launched in 1843, our friendly team are ready to welcome visitors on board. The ship, designed by Britain's most iconic engineer Isambard Kingdom Brunel, has been painstakingly restored to recreate Victorian life at sea on the world’s first great luxury liner. Climb aboard and explore scenes so life-like you’ll feel as if you’ve stepped back in time. There are two fascinating museums, as well as the dry dock, where the ship was originally built, to explore, providing hours of engrossing wonder.

From £6.80Banksy, Blackbeard and Beyond: A Bristol Self Guided Walking Tour
In 2006, Bristol woke up to find a cheeky mural on a wall — and 97% of residents voted to keep it. That mural by Banksy changed how an entire city thinks about street art. This self-guided audio walking tour takes you there, and through 1,000 years of Bristol's best stories — from the pub where Blackbeard planned his raids and Defoe found Robinson Crusoe, to a medieval clock with two minute hands and where the phrase "pay on the nail" was born. Available in 9 languages with offline access, you start whenever you like, pause for a pint at a 17th-century inn, and pick up right where you left off. No group to follow, no fixed schedule — just your phone, headphones, and 14 stops across Bristol, a city reckoning honestly with its slave-trading past.
